I am trying to convert from MSMoney to FM.
Mark suggested to use *.quif as the vehicle.
However, the MSMoney generated *.quif does not contain symbols, just the names of the investments.
Importing works great, except that the generated *.dat files have crazy names.
For instance, importing an ExxonMobil transaction makes a exxonmo.dat file, instead of a XOM.dat file.

To get around this dilemma, I have manually made a xom.dat file first, using New Investment with Price=1. Then used the quif import.

Is this the recommended way of going about this, or is there a better way?

I have been thinking of making a *.CSV file with the names and symbols and then importing it as a generic, followed by a *.quif import. In this case, I need
to enter a bogus number of shares in BNUM, so it imports.

From here, it looks like I may have to do a lot of typing. My wife has offered to help. We have a lot of symbols.....

Hi Juergen,

The investment filenames are really irrelevant. I wouldn't worry about what they are named. I would do the the .QIF import, and then change the investment properties for each investment to have the correct symbol. From within the Portfolio Editor, right mouse click on an investment, and choose "Properties...", and change the symbol there.

When a .QIF file doesn't have symbols, the new investments will be created with the name in both the name and symbol fields. You'll just want to update the symbols after the import, so you can retrieve prices okay.
